• 1939 Anderton Springs Established in Bingley West Yorkshire GB- producing springs.
  • 1953 Commenced Circlip production.
  • 1960-70 Steady expansion in Europe & USA & company acquired by Southcros Ltd.
  • Opened overseas branch in Italy.
  • 1970-80 Won the ‘Queens Award for Export Achievement’.
  • Ownership changed as company became part of the Aurora Group & company became Anderton International Ltd.
  • 1980-90 Further development & production enhancements including Induction Heat Treatment.
  • Acquired the Salterfix retaining ring business.
  • Achieved numerous quality accreditations including – ISO 9002, Q1,VDA6, EAQF A grade.
  • 1983 Acquisition by SKF Fastening Systems (including Seeger-Orbis D, Seeger Reno Brazil & Waldes/IRR USA.
  • 1995 SKF sold Retaining Ring Group to TransTechnology Corporation USA.
  • 1996/97 Seeger factory in Eichen closed & transferred to Anderton UK.
  • 1999 Commenced relocation & consolidation of business on the Ellison site in Glusburn to create TransTechnology GB.
  • 1953 Ellison Established in Bingley West Yorkshire GB- producing spring clips.


  • 1960-70 Relocated to Harden factory & commenced producing Circlips.


  • 1970-80 Developed ‘in house’ wire production & introduced new packaging techniques ‘stacked’ Circlips.


  • Opened overseas branches in Germany (initially Saarbruecken, later Krefeld) & France (Paris).


  • 1980-90 Further development & acquisition of additional businesses in production of spring washers & metal finishing (zinc plating).


  • Opened additional branch in Spain (Barcelona) & introduced 100% tested Circlips.


  • Achieved numerous quality accreditations including – ISO 9002, Q1,VDA6, EAQF A grade..


  • Won the ‘Queens Award for Export Achievement on 3 occasions between 1972 & 1997.


  • 1997 Relocated to new facility in Glusburn & achieved QS 9000.


  • 1999 Business acquired by TransTechnology Corporation USA.

 

 
To Date

2002
Cirteq Ltd Formed
